I have spent fifteen years advising companies on their procurement strategies. And I keep noticing the same blind spot. Teams spend weeks comparing technical specs, warranty terms, and price tags. But almost nobody asks the question that actually determines whether a purchase will work out: does this hardware fit how we actually operate as a group?

The mismatch usually shows up three months after the order arrives. A manufacturing team buys rugged tablets because the sales material promises military-grade durability. Then nobody carries them to the shop floor because the devices are too heavy for the way technicians move between stations. Or a remote sales force gets lightweight laptops that save weight but require a separate dock for every desk they visit. The cost of the hardware was fine. The cost of the friction was not.

I recently worked with a mid-sized logistics firm that had been through three different handheld computer vendors in two years. Each time, the purchasing department ran a clean comparison of processors and battery life. Each time, the devices ended up in a drawer. The real issue had nothing to do with specs. The real issue was that their team rotated shifts and shared devices without formal check-out. The previous hardware locked each unit to a single user login. Every handoff meant a three-minute reboot. On a busy floor, that killed adoption. They finally switched to a device line that supports quick user switching and shared mode logins. So how do you find the fit before you order? Let me walk you through the patterns I have seen work and the ones that fail.

Trace the daily friction points

Pick one ordinary day on the floor. Who touches the device first? Who hands it off next? How many times does someone have to wait for a boot, a login, or a saved file location? I have watched teams reject perfectly good hardware simply because the power button placement forced a grip change. That is not a spec sheet problem. That is a habit problem. Audit the micro-annoyances. They tell you more than any benchmark test.

Match device behavior to team rhythm

Some teams sprint between tasks. Others dwell in one application for hours. A team that jumps between locations needs devices that resume from sleep instantly and keep the wireless stack alive. A team that runs a single inventory app all day wants a bigger screen and a longer charge cycle. I have seen companies buy ultra-portable models for warehouse staff who never leave the building. The thinness gave them nothing. The reduced battery gave them a problem. Watch how your people actually move before you judge the form factor.

Look at how training actually happens

Most hardware vendors assume a structured training session with a manual. Real teams learn from the guy on the next station. If your culture relies on peer-to-peer knowledge transfer, the device interface needs to be consistent across models. When a new hire picks up a scanner, it should behave like the scanner two stations over. I once consulted for a company that used three different scanner brands because each department bought independently. New hires spent a week learning three interfaces. Morale dropped. The fix was a single ecosystem with a unified launcher.

Account for how you support the hardware

Many teams do not have a dedicated IT person on the floor. That means the supervisor or the most experienced operator ends up as the de facto tech support. If the hardware requires proprietary cables, proprietary updates, or a web portal for battery management, that support person burns hours on nonsense. I have seen teams succeed with hardware that has a simple reset button and a standard USB-C charger, even if the device itself is somewhat less advanced. Complexity breeds friction. Friction kills adoption. Choose hardware that the non-technical person on your team can keep running.

Test with the least enthusiastic user

When you evaluate a new device, do not let the most tech-savvy person on your team do the trial. They can make anything work. Pick the person who resists change. The person who still uses a paper clipboard for half their job. If that person finds the device tolerable after a week, you have a winner. If they keep leaving it on the charger, you have a signal that the real requirements are not met. I have seen three major rollouts saved that way. I have seen two rollouts pushed through by executives against user feedback, and both ended up gathering dust.

So the next time you sit down to compare hardware prices and specs, pause. Ask yourself what the daily workflow actually looks like. Ask how the device will be shared, carried, charged, and handed over. The numbers matter. But the culture matters more.

  • Map the handoff points where a device changes hands between shifts
  • Test candidate hardware with the heaviest gloves your team wears
  • Check how many seconds a cold boot takes compared to a resume from sleep
  • Verify that the battery can be swapped without shutting down the OS
  • Confirm that the default interface language matches your team’s preference
  • Run the trial for two weeks minimum, not one day
